products that bring joy nationwide every day! Summary: The
Maintenance Technician is responsible for troubleshooting,
repairing, and maintaining production equipment, facility systems,
and utilities across electrical, mechanical, and refrigeration
disciplines. This role supports safe and efficient operations by
performing preventive and corrective maintenance, interpreting
technical documentation, and collaborating with operations and
engineering teams. Ideal candidates bring specialized expertise in
one of the following: industrial electrical systems, ammonia
refrigeration systems, or industrial mechanical systems. What
You’ll Do: • Repair, install, and maintain production equipment,
facility systems, and utilities. • Perform specialized work
depending on assigned track: Refrigeration: Maintain ammonia
refrigeration, boilers, HVAC, compressors, glycol, steam, and
chilled water systems; support PSM/HAZMAT compliance. Electrical:
Install/repair motors, VFDs, transformers, control circuits,
alarms, and 3-phase power up to 480V; troubleshoot electrical
schematics and control systems. Mechanical: Repair freezers,
conveyors, filling machines, pumps, pneumatics, hydraulics; perform
welding, fabrication, machining, and mechanical rebuilds. •
Troubleshoot mechanical, electrical, and control issues using
meters, gauges, and diagnostic tools. • Read and interpret
blueprints, schematics, and technical drawings. • Perform
preventive maintenance and maintain accurate CMMS documentation. •
Support safety programs including GMP, HAZMAT, and emergency
response. • Operate forklifts, man lifts, and tools required for
repair and installation. • Work in extreme temperatures and
variable indoor/outdoor environments. Experience You’ll Need: High
school diploma or GED required. Must meet one of the specialization
requirements below: Refrigeration: NYS-approved HVAC/R
apprenticeship or 2-year degree 3 years ammonia/multi-gas
experience. Electrical: NYS-approved electrician apprenticeship or
2-year degree 3 years industrial electrical experience. Mechanical:
NYS-approved millwright/mechanical apprenticeship or 2-year
mechanical/mechatronics degree 3 years industrial mechanic
experience. Ability to lift 50 lbs, climb, squat, bend, and work at
heights with fall protection. Proficiency with hand tools, power
tools, and diagnostic equipment. Ability to wear a respirator and
maintain HAZMAT certification. Ability to read schematics and
technical diagrams. Forklift certification or willingness to
obtain. Bonus: CARO/CIRO, Stationary Engineer License, PLC
